Do I need a company secretary?
All companies have company secretarial responsibilities. It is no longer necessary for private limited companies to appoint a company secretary.
The directors of a company can undertake the recording, reporting and filing duties or the company secretary. Alternatively, they can assign them to another staff member or commission an external party to compete the duties for them.
